Some info on Neosho plucked from another thread.
JUCO news.
by Swayz ยป Wed Nov 02, 2011 8:55 pm I did the announcing for the Pratt CC at #20 Neosho CCC dual. Started at 125 125#3 Vesta (N) WBF in 51 seconds over Zachary Hoehn 133 LeRoy Barnes (N)17-1 tech over Skyler McComb 141 Forrest Caroll (P) 5-4 dec Javon Haines 149 John Lynch (P) 11-4 over Trent Robb 157 Keegan Smith (P) 5-0 over Jonathan Barnat 165 Cody Hill (N) wbf 1:55 over Adam Klien (backup 157 thrust into starting position after starter Colten Picking quit the team this morning when he was 6lbs over) 174 Landon Keiswetter (P) WBF in OT over #6 Edwin Gutierrez 184 Taylor Baird (P) WBF over Chad Wampler 197 Cole Carr (N) WBF over Dustin Hackett ... Team Score going into HWT: NCCC 23 Pratt 21 285 Zotaih Tuaquoi (P) WBF over Adam Wakefield Pratt wins 27-23.
Some solid kids on both teams and many of the falls came off of some slick, good wrestling on both sides 3 pins by each team . Neosho won all 4 of their matches by bonus with 3 pins and a Tech. Barnes for Neosho is pretty solid, I thought Baird kid was just as impressive as I remembered watching him last year in the 4a State Finals. Keiswetter was down big and kept composure and was a strong finisher in his college debut against a solid Gutierrez, who just got in a bad position and then was called pinned in OT.
